Association between allergic diseases and obesity

ABSTRACT

Both obesity and allergic diseases are considered as health problems that have increased their incidence during the last years. Both of them are considered as a real health problem; and since the mentioned increase, it has been proposed that obesity may be a causative factor in the development of allergic diseases. Our objective was to analyze the obesity incidence in a group of allergic population. It was performed a study in children suffering from allergic diseases and living in the Comerica Laugher, through a free campaign to diagnose asthma and other allergic diseases. This campaign was promoted by the Health Direction and Municipal Assistance of the city of Torreón, Coahuila State. In such a campaign, the patients were weighed and measured –tallness– and an allergist carried out a complete evaluation that included a clinical examination and skin tests. For the objective of this study, only children being from 5 to13 years old were selected. Twenty-nine children being of the mentioned ages and suffering from asthma, allergic rhinitis and atopic dermatitis were considered for the study. A prevalence of overweight and a percentage of 44.8% of obesity was found among them, against the reported data for obesity (25%) present in the general population. Because of this, we consider that overweight and obesity may have some influence in the development of allergic diseases.
